  7. Please rule out potential medical conditions. My dd became very unhappy and mean spirited just before her ninth birthday. It went on for months before I began searching for a good therapist in our area. The week before the first appointment (in part, thanks to the hive) we discovered she had type 1 diabetes. Once she received treatment we had our old daughter back.
